Freeze damage in Luzerne County doesn't always show up immediately. A supply line that developed micro-fractures during a cold spell may leak slowly for months before symptoms appear. Nanticoke homeowners with older galvanized or copper supply lines — especially near exterior walls or crawlspaces — should consider professional detection after any winter with multiple freeze events.

Underground Pipe Joint Displacement

Expansive clay soils in Luzerne County push and pull buried pipe runs as moisture levels change through the seasons. The lateral movement displaces joints in older cast-iron, galvanized, and PVC underground lines — creating leaks that saturate the surrounding soil without surfacing for months.

Foundation Crack from Soil Saturation

Slab leaks that go undetected long enough will saturate the soil beneath the foundation in Nanticoke. Saturated clay soil loses load-bearing capacity and allows differential foundation settlement — producing cracks in drywall, sticking doors, and visible foundation movement. By this stage, the leak has been running for months.

📡

Electronic Leak Detection in Nanticoke

Electronic leak detection uses acoustic amplifiers and pipe correlators to locate leaks in pressurized water lines without breaking walls or digging. Sound analysis identifies the leak location within inches.

Meter & Pressure Test

A meter isolation test confirms active water loss and quantifies the leak rate. Pressure testing isolates the affected supply zone — narrowing the detection area before acoustic or thermal scanning begins.

Professional detection in Nanticoke eliminates guesswork from the repair process. Without knowing the exact leak location, plumbers must open multiple access points or make educated guesses about pipe routing. A confirmed detection report gives the repair contractor a precise target — reducing labor time, repair scope, and total cost for Luzerne County homeowners.

Non-invasive detection methods used in Nanticoke — acoustic correlation, thermal imaging, and electronic line tracing — locate leaks without breaking walls, lifting floors, or digging.
